Bill would Allow Illegals to attend California Community Colleges for FREE!!!
The Home of Uncommon Sense ^ | 06/19/2006 | Craig DeLuz

Posted on 06/19/2006 2:43:49 PM PDT by Craig DeLuz

State Senator Gill Cedillo, infamous for his effort to give drivers licenses to illegal immigrants has now wants to allow them to get grants provided to UC and CSU students and would make them eligible to receive the Community College Boar d of Governor’s Fee Waiver that would allow them to attend Community College in California for free.
